    The target: XKR5, gene name: XKR5, also named as HARL2754, UNQ2754, XRG5A, XRG5BM. Predicted to be involved in apoptotic process involved in development; engulfment of apoptotic cell; and phosphatidylserine exposure on apoptotic cell surface. Predicted to be integral component of membrane. Predicted to be active in plasma membrane.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022].
